Linux-libre 5.7 je već objavljen, kernel bez vlasničkih elemenata i komponenti

La Predstavljena Latinoamerička fondacija za slobodni softver nedavno objavljivanje nova verzija potpuno "besplatan" od Linux Kernela 5.7 "Linux-libre 5.7-gnu" čija je glavna karakteristika da nema elemenata firmvera i upravljačkih programa koji sadrže zaštićene komponente ili dijelove koda čiju primjenu ograničava proizvođač.

Linux besplatno je jezgro koje preporučuje Fondacija za slobodni softver i glavni dio GNU distribucije potpuno bez vlasničkih fragmenata ili uključenog firmvera u Linuxu se koriste za inicijalizaciju uređaja ili primjenu zakrpa na njih koje rješavaju hardverske kvarove koji se nisu mogli ispraviti prije nego što su postali dostupni korisnicima.

Upravljački program učitava firmware u uređaj, čineći dio ovog, a samim tim i jezgre. Poznato je da ove firmware sadrže ranjivosti koje mogu utjecati na Linux uprkos upotrebi besplatnih upravljačkih programa, kao što je Intel Management Engine.

U nekim slučajevima bez firmvera nije moguće upravljati uređajem, čineći ga beskorisnim. To dovodi do manje hardvera kompatibilnog s Linux-om od Linux-a.

O Linux-Libreu

Kada govorimo o uređajima, uključen je i CPU računara. To znači da računari mogu postati potpuno neupotrebljivi ako vaš mikroprocesor takođe zahtijeva korektivni firmver za ispravno funkcioniranje.

Takođe, Linux-libre onemogućava funkcije jezgre za učitavanje neslobodnih komponenata koje nisu dio pripreme jezgre i uklanja dokumentaciju iz upotrebe neslobodnih komponenata.

Da bi očistila jezgru od neslobodnih dijelova, stvorena je univerzalna skripta ljuske kao dio projekta Linux-libre, koja sadrži tisuće predložaka za utvrđivanje prisutnosti binarnih umetaka i uklanjanje lažnih pozitivnih rezultata.

Gotove zakrpe zasnovane na upotrebi gore navedene skripte takođe su dostupne za preuzimanje.

Korištenje Linux-libre jezgre preporučuje se u distribucijama koje zadovoljavaju kriterije Open Source Foundation za izgradnju potpuno besplatne GNU / Linux distribucije. Na primjer, Linux-libre kernel se koristi u distribucijama kao što su Dragora Linux, Trisquel, Dyne: Bolic, gNewSense, Parabola, Musix i Kongoni.

Iako je glavni nedostatak korištenja ovog kernela i koji je po defaultu poznat, uklanjanje firmvera sa određenog hardvera kao što su neke Wi-Fi kartice, zvučne kartice i grafičke kartice s posebnim naglaskom na NVIDIA

Glavne nove značajke Linux-libre 5.7

U ovoj novoj verziji Linux-Libre Kernela 5.7 rad fokusiran na uklanjanje koda iz nekih upravljačkih programa.

Takav je haos onemogućen kôd koji se bavi ukrcavanjem blob datoteka u upravljački programi za Marvell OcteonTX CPT, Mediatek MT7622 WMAC, Qualcomm IPA, Azoteq IQS62x MFD, IDT 82P33xxx PTP i MHI sabirnice.

Pored činjenice da je čišćenje i modifikacija blob koda kako bi se uzelo u obzir novo sučelje za učitavanje firmvera i nove blobove na AMD GPU drajverima i podsustavima, Arm64 DTS, Meson VDec, Realtek Bluetooth, m88ds3103 frontend dvb, Mediatek mt8173 VPU, Qualcomm Venus, Broadcom FMAC, Mediatek 7622/7663 wifi.

Od ostalih promjena koji se spominju u oglasu:

  • Smatra se premještanje mscc upravljačkog programa i dokumentacija u wd719x.
  • Upravljački program i1480 uwb zaustavio je čišćenje zbog uklanjanja iz jezgre.
  • Uklonjene izvršne blobove ukrašene kao skupovi brojeva dodani u kontroler i915 i korišteni za Gen7 GPU-ove.
  • U skripti za deblob-provjeru riješeni su problemi sa samoprovjerom i ponovljeni su neki standardni predložaci za isticanje BLOB-a.

Kako mogu dobiti i instalirati Linux-Libre na svoju distribuciju?

Za one koji su zainteresirani za mogućnost isprobavanja ovog Linux-Libre kernela, glavna preporuka za one koji se ne osjećaju sigurno ili nemaju potrebno znanje za obavljanje kompilacije, to bolje odlučite se koristiti bilo koju od gore spomenutih distribucija koji koriste ovaj kernel.

U slučaju da želite nabaviti pakete za provođenje kompilacije, možete ih dobiti odlaskom na na sljedeći link ili takođe možete provjeriti sljedeće informacije o distribucijama uz podršku za APT. 


Ostavite komentar

Vaša e-mail adresa neće biti objavljena. Obavezna polja su označena sa *

*

*

  1. Odgovoran za podatke: AB Internet Networks 2008 SL
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obavezi.
  5. Pohrana podataka: Baza podataka koju hostuje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.